负载均衡集群在当今的互联网世界中扮演着至关重要的角色,它能够将大量流量分配到多个服务器上,从而提高系统的可用性、可靠性和性能,以下是负载均衡集群的主要功能:

流量分发
负载均衡集群的核心功能是将进入系统的流量合理地分配到不同的服务器上。
实现方式:
- 轮询:按照一定顺序将请求分配给不同的服务器。
- 最少连接:将请求分配给当前连接数最少的服务器。
- 响应时间:将请求分配给响应时间最短的服务器。
经验案例:某电商网站在高峰时段,通过负载均衡集群将流量均匀分配到各个服务器,有效提高了网站的访问速度和稳定性。
高可用性
当某台服务器出现故障时,负载均衡集群能够自动将流量转移到其他正常工作的服务器上。
实现方式:
- 健康检查:定期检查服务器状态,确保只有正常工作的服务器才能接收流量。
- 故障转移:当检测到服务器故障时,自动将流量转移到其他服务器。
经验案例:某银行在部署负载均衡集群时,采用了健康检查和故障转移机制,确保了银行系统的稳定运行。
性能优化
通过将流量分配到多个服务器,负载均衡集群可以有效地提高系统的性能。

实现方式:
- 缓存:将热点数据缓存到内存中,减少对数据库的访问次数。
- 压缩:对数据进行压缩,减少网络传输的数据量。
经验案例:某视频网站通过负载均衡集群和缓存技术,提高了视频播放的流畅性。
安全防护
负载均衡集群可以提供一定程度的网络安全防护。
实现方式:
- DDoS攻击防护:通过识别和过滤恶意流量,保护服务器免受DDoS攻击。
- HTTPS加密:对传输数据进行加密,提高数据安全性。
经验案例:某政府网站通过负载均衡集群和HTTPS加密技术,保障了网站数据的安全。
可扩展性
负载均衡集群可以根据业务需求,动态调整服务器数量和配置。
实现方式:

- 自动扩缩容:根据流量变化自动增加或减少服务器。
- 自定义配置:允许用户根据需求调整负载均衡策略。
经验案例:某在线教育平台在高峰时段,通过负载均衡集群自动扩容,确保了平台的稳定运行。
FAQs
Q1:负载均衡集群与反向代理有什么区别?
A1:负载均衡集群和反向代理都是用于处理流量的技术,但它们的作用有所不同,负载均衡集群主要用于将流量分配到多个服务器,提高系统的可用性和性能;而反向代理则主要用于处理外部请求,将请求转发到内部服务器。
Q2:负载均衡集群的常见应用场景有哪些?
A2:负载均衡集群的常见应用场景包括:
- 电商平台:提高网站的访问速度和稳定性。
- 在线教育平台:保障平台的稳定运行。
- 政府网站:提高网站的安全性。
- 游戏服务器:确保游戏流畅运行。
国内详细文献权威来源
《负载均衡技术原理与实现》(清华大学出版社)
《云计算技术与应用》(电子工业出版社)
图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/273661.html

